エラーで強制終了?No.02084
ばご さん 00/12/08 10:47
 
初めまして。
意地悪な使い方なので、通常では起きないのかもしれませんが、強制終了はよろしく
ないと思いますので報告します。

Windows2000で使用中に、メール送受信時のダイヤルアップ接続を「Windows側にまか
せる」にして、コントロールパネルのインターネットオプションで「接続しない」を
選んである場合、手動でダイヤルアップせずに「送受信」ボタンをクリックすると、
「サーバーが見つからない」というエラーになります。エラーダイアログを閉じて、
そのまま、もう一度「送受信」ボタンをクリックすると、強制終了してしまいます。


[ ]
RE:02084 エラーで強制終了?No.02097
秀まるお さん 00/12/08 13:10
 
> Windows2000で使用中に、メール送受信時のダイヤルアップ接続を「Windows側にまか
> せる」にして、コントロールパネルのインターネットオプションで「接続しない」を
> 選んである場合、手動でダイヤルアップせずに「送受信」ボタンをクリックすると、
> 「サーバーが見つからない」というエラーになります。エラーダイアログを閉じて、
> そのまま、もう一度「送受信」ボタンをクリックすると、強制終了してしまいます。

 僕の所のWindows95のノートパソコンとWindows2000のデスクトップ上でLANを無効
にしてテストしてみた限りはうまく再現しませんでした。

 送受信をすると、毎回

    po.mitene.or.jp というホストが見つかりません。エラーコード = 11001

 とのエラーメッセージが出て、そのあと「送受信」ダイアログボックスを「閉じ
る」として、それを何回やっても同じ結果にしかなりませんでした。

 Windows2000のマシンはIE5.0、Windows95のマシンはIE5.5です。

 死んだ時にDr.Watsonのログが作成されていれば、それを教えて欲しいです。それ
で原因が分かる可能性が高いです。

[ ]
RE:02097 エラーで強制終了?No.02178
ばご さん 00/12/12 10:54
 
Dr.Watsonのログは作成されていないようです。私自身プログラミングについては、
あまり詳しくないので教えていただきたいのですが、Dr.Watsonのログというのは、
何か設定をして採取するものなのでしょうか?

現状では、「0x00452762の命令が0x000000001のメモリを参照しましたが"read"にな
ることはありませんでした。」というダイアログが出て、OKをクリックしても、キャ
ンセルをクリックしても、そのままダイアログが閉じられるだけです。

> Windows2000のマシンはIE5.0、Windows95のマシンはIE5.5です。
>
> 死んだ時にDr.Watsonのログが作成されていれば、それを教えて欲しいです。それ
>で原因が分かる可能性が高いです。

[ ]
RE:02178 エラーで強制終了?No.02194
秀まるお さん 00/12/12 18:45
 
> 現状では、「0x00452762の命令が0x000000001のメモリを参照しましたが"read"にな
> ることはありませんでした。」というダイアログが出て、OKをクリックしても、キャ
> ンセルをクリックしても、そのままダイアログが閉じられるだけです。

 とりあえずその情報だけでも調査できるので調べてみます。

 ちなみにDr.Watsonは設定も何もしなくても勝手に裏で動いていると思います。死
んだ後にハードディスクのWindowsNTのフォルダの配下から「drw*.log」というファ
イルを検索すると、たぶんそれらしきログファイルが出てくると思います。

 もし見つかれば、その中の鶴亀メールが死んだ時の部分だけ教えて欲しいです。

[ ]
RE:02178 エラーで強制終了?No.02204
秀まるお さん 00/12/13 12:05
 
> 現状では、「0x00452762の命令が0x000000001のメモリを参照しましたが"read"にな
> ることはありませんでした。」というダイアログが出て、OKをクリックしても、キャ
> ンセルをクリックしても、そのままダイアログが閉じられるだけです。

 すみません。もう既にV0.55以下のソースコードその他を削除してしまいました。
ってことで、そのアドレスから場所を特定することが出来ませんでした。

 すみませんが、V0.56またはV0.57での死んだときのメッセージを教えてください。
または面倒でしたらまた将来のバージョンでもかまいません。

[ ]
RE:02204 エラーで強制終了?No.02330
ばご さん 00/12/19 10:54
 
> すみませんが、V0.56またはV0.57での死んだときのメッセージを教えてください。
>または面倒でしたらまた将来のバージョンでもかまいません。
>
遅くなって済みません。本日v0.59をインストールして実験してみました。結果は、

"0x00456aba"の命令が"0x000000001"のメモリを参照しました。メモリが"read"にな
ることはできませんでした。

となりました。よろしくお願いします。

[ ]
RE:02330 エラーで強制終了?No.02337
秀まるお さん 00/12/19 18:31
 
> "0x00456aba"の命令が"0x000000001"のメモリを参照しました。メモリが"read"にな
> ることはできませんでした。

 調べてみたら、その場所は特定できたんですが、その呼び出し元が60箇所くらい
ありました。とりあえず怪しそうな場所はないかと30個くらい調べていいかげんい
やになりました。

 しつこいようですけど、ワトソン博士のログがあればその内容(の一番最後のログ
)を教えてください。

 drw*.*をハードディスクから検索すればあると思います。そもそも、WindowsNTま
たはWindows2000だって話が前提ですけど。

 あ、Windows95/98/Meの場合なら、ワトソン博士のログではなくて、死んだときの
メッセージの「詳細>>」を押して出てくる内容を連絡いただければ、それでもいいで
す。

[ ]
RE:02330 エラーで強制終了?No.02353
PATIO さん 00/12/20 08:45
 
ぱごさんはプログラミングには詳しくないとの事なので
開発ツールはインストールされていないと思うのですが、
実際はどうなんでしょうか?
私の環境がNT4.0なのでおなじかどうか分かりませんが、
WinNT¥System32の下にDrwtsn32.exeというファイルが
あると思います。これをダブルクリックするとログファイルのパス名
とか色々と設定できるようになっていると思いますので
これを一度確認されてはどうかと思います。
また、Drwtsn32.exe -iで起動すれば、エラー発生時に
ワトソン博士が起動される環境になるとHELPにありましたので
それを試してみられてもいいかもしれません。

私の環境はVCがインストールされているのでそっちが立ち上がる
ようになっているらしく、ワトソン博士は起動されないようです。

ちなみに設定をいじってなければシステムディレクトリにログが
出るようになっているとHELPに書いてありました。

[ ]
RE:02330 エラーで強制終了?No.02359
秀まるお さん 00/12/20 09:33
 
 うむ、やっぱりWindows95/98の「詳細>>」だけでは出力される情報が少なくて困る
可能性があるので、自前でワトソンログ相当の物を出すことにします。

 今も既に「スレッドの同期に失敗」とかDEBUGMESSAGEの時は出してるので、それを
保護違反発生時にも出すようにすればいいのでした。

 (既に秀ネットのシステムではやってることだし)

 ってことで、次のバージョン(V0.60)にて一度死なせてみて、dump.txtというフ
ァイルが出力されるので、それを送ってください。ってことでお願いします。

[ ]
RE:02359 エラーで強制終了?No.02384
ばご さん 00/12/20 20:10
 
> ってことで、次のバージョン(V0.60)にて一度死なせてみて、
> dump.txtというファイルが出力されるので、それを送ってください。
>ってことでお願いします。

v0.60で、dump.txt を出力しましたが、ここに載せてしまってよろしいでしょうか?
それとも、メールなどで直接お送りした方がよいでしょうか?

[ ]
RE:02384 エラーで強制終了?No.02385
山紫水明 さん 00/12/20 21:01
 
 ばごさん こんばんは。

》v0.60で、dump.txt を出力しましたが、ここに載せてしまってよろしいでしょう
》か?それとも、メールなどで直接お送りした方がよいでしょうか?

 私も以前に送ったことがあります。10行以上にわたるようでしたら直接送る,そ
れ以下でしたらここに載せていいのではないでしょうか。,

 では, (^^)/~
                                        山紫水明


[ ]
RE:02385 エラーで強制終了?No.02402
ばご さん 00/12/21 10:57
 
山紫水明さん、ご助言ありがとうございます。

ファイルは128文字×20行くらいありそうなので、直接お送りしようと思いますが、
どちらにお送りすれば(メールアドレス)よいのでしょうか?

>
> 私も以前に送ったことがあります。10行以上にわたるようでしたら直接送る,そ
>れ以下でしたらここに載せていいのではないでしょうか。,
>
> では, (^^)/~
>                                        山紫水明
>

[ ]
RE:02402 エラーで強制終了?No.02412
秀まるお さん 00/12/21 11:52
 
>ファイルは128文字×20行くらいありそうなので、直接お送りしようと思いますが、
>どちらにお送りすれば(メールアドレス)よいのでしょうか?

 っという書き込みをしている間に会議室に書き込んでもらった方が早いような
気がしますが…。

 僕の宛先は、  maruo@mitene.or.jp です。

 ってこと出よろしくお願いします。

[ ]
RE:02412 エラーで強制終了?No.02443
ばご さん 00/12/21 23:20
 
v0.61で直りました。ありがとうございました。

[ ]